5 Afterward he measured a thousand. And it was a river that I could not pass over, for the water had risen, enough water to swim in, a river that could not be passed over.
6 He said to me, “Son of man, have you seen this?”Then he brought me and caused me to return to the brink of the river.
7 When I had returned I saw on the bank of the river very many trees on the one side and on the other.
8 Then he said to me, “This water flows toward the eastern region and goes down into the valley, and enters the sea. When it flows into the sea, the water will become fresh.
9 Every living creature that swarms, wherever the rivers go, will live. And there shall be a very great multitude of fish, because these waters shall come there and the others become fresh. Thus everything shall live wherever the river comes.
10 It shall come to pass that the fishermen shall stand upon it. From En Gedi even to En Eglaim there shall be a place to spread out nets. Their fish shall be according to their kinds, as the fish of the Mediterranean Sea, exceedingly many.
11 But its miry places and its marshes shall not be healed. They shall be given to salt.
